What we do know is reports of people jumping off balconies are rare at home, but fairly common in Pattaya. So some further thought and discussion is helpful.

Most people have a support system, family, friends, colleagues in their home country. However many expats don't/can't replace that network when they move to somewhere like Pattaya. They are so emotionally, and perhaps financially, invested in that move, and perhaps invested in an individual as a partner, that when it doesn't work out the overwhelming sense of failure is too much, and makes a return to their own country impossible. The jump is the out.

Not every faller is thrown.
